K–911
Many airports are vulnerable to wild animals crossing the runway, which could result in a serious safety hazard. This is something you may not have given much thought to. Many airports have solved this problem by setting up traps to scare the animals away from the danger all around them, but Cherry Capital Airport in Michigan chose an alternative approach. In order to keep all travelers and airlines safe, they made the decision to hire Piper, a Border Collie, to run the perimeter of the airport and chase away any animals.

Runway Operations
Whether you are frightened of flying or not, looking at this photo will give anyone a panic attack. This is a serious violation of aviation safety regulations, and a catastrophic accident is almost a given. Fortunately, photographer Mike Kelley only altered this photo. The artwork, which he called “Wake Turbulence,” shows every plane leaving Los Angeles International Airport (LAX). It was created by doctoring together 400 separate photos.
